How To Fix CUSDIR501 - This logon language is not transported


CUSDIR501 - Overview

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: CUSDIR - Originality Attributes for Customizing Tables

  • Message number: 501

  • Message text: This logon language is not transported

  • What causes this issue?

    You are logged on in language &V1&. However, the system is set so that
    only a certain number of languages is transported. This language is not
    once of them, which means that any texts you create in this language
    will not be exported.

    System Response

    The system issues an error message and will not allow you to continue with this transaction until the error is resolved.

    How to fix this error?

    Log on in another language, if necessary.

    Procedure for System Administrators

    The languages that are transported are set by the value of the
    parameter <LS>LANGUAGE</> in the transport profile. You can use the
    Transport Management System (Transaction STMS) to edit the transport
    profile of the system.
    The current value of <LS>LANGUAGE</> is &V2&.
